Sheffield Train Station, known officially as Sheffield Midland, is a bustling hub situated in the heart of the city. As one of the busiest stations in South Yorkshire, it connects locals and travelers to a vast network of destinations throughout the UK. Whether you're commuting for work, exploring as a tourist, or just passing through, Sheffield Station provides an array of facilities to ensure a seamless travel experience.
Sheffield Station boasts a wide range of amenities to make your journey comfortable. The station offers ticket offices with extensive opening hours—Monday to Saturday from 05:00 to 22:50 and on Sundays from 07:45 to 23:00. Ticket machines are readily available for quick and easy purchases, and online tickets can be collected on-site with ease. For those using smartcards, validators and issuance are accessible, enhancing the efficiency of travel.
The station is designed with accessibility in mind. With step-free access across all areas, tactile paving, and available ramps for train access, travel is made convenient for passengers with mobility impairments. Sheffield Station also offers accessible tickets machines and toilets, plus convenient seating areas. While there aren't accessible taxis directly at the station, there is an impaired mobility set down/pick-up point, assuring safe and straightforward transit to and from the station.
For continued travel, Sheffield Station is connected to a variety of public transport services. Rail replacement buses operate from bus stands E5 and E6, and a taxi rank is located right at the station front. Additionally, the station connects seamlessly with Sheffield's 'Stagecoach Supertram,' which stops conveniently beside the station, providing an easy transfer to various parts of the city. For journeys further afield, TransPennine Express offers frequent direct services to Manchester Airport.

Welcome to Corkerhill, a quaint but essential train station situated in the city of Glasgow, Scotland. Whether you're a local commuter or a visitor looking to discover the wonders of Scotland, Corkerhill offers a gateway to a variety of destinations. With its unique charm and strategic position, it provides a convenient spot for embarking on journeys near and far, making it a key part of the region’s public transport infrastructure.
At Corkerhill, simplicity is the key. Though the station lacks a ticket office or machines, buying tickets is a breeze online and smartcard users can validate their cards here.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access throughout, classified as a Category A station. For safety and security, there's a customer help point and CCTV coverage ensuring that all passengers can travel with confidence.
While amenities such as restrooms, refreshment facilities, and shops are not available at the station, Corkerhill does offer a seating area for those waiting for their train. Despite the lack of some services, the station maintains a tidy and efficient environment perfect for transit.
Getting around from Corkerhill is straightforward due to its well-connected transport links. The station serves as a pick-up and drop-off point for rail replacement services on Corkerhill Road, just before the bridge. Taxis can be conveniently booked through the Train Taxi service. For bus services, you can visit Travel Line Scotland or give them a call for any queries about routes and timings. Bus stops are easily accessible, ensuring a smooth transition between rail and road travel.
Corkerhill connects you to key locations within Glasgow and beyond. Just a short train ride away is Glasgow Central, perfect for those looking to explore the city's vibrant heart. Similarly, you can hop on a train to Paisley Canal, offering a leisurely ride to this charming locale. Keen to catch an event? Head over to the Exhibition Centre (Glasgow) from Corkerhill with ease. The station also provides routes to other notable destinations such as Crookston, Bridgeton, and Edinburgh's Waverley station.
Other frequent destinations include Cambuslang, Partick, and Hawkhead, each offering unique experiences. Whether your next stop is bustling Glasgow or the peaceful outskirts, Corkerhill is a reliable starting point.
